Finance Review — Logistics Transition. Effective Q3, Harlin Freightworks replaces Ostrell Carriage as primary logistics provider. Projected annual savings: 11% on distribution spend, driven by consolidated routing from the Verandale hub. Transition costs of one-time onboarding and dual-running for six weeks are absorbed in the current budget. Service-level penalties are stricter under the new contract. Department heads should flag shipment-critical dates by Friday. Wider implications for next year's plans are noted below.

management briefing: Goroxix Systems is in early talks to buy Kelethek Holdings for about $118.0 million. The Sileth launch date is February 25, and nothing goes to the press before then. Legal wants the Pelokox Logistics term sheet withdrawn before December 14.

Handover note — Tillage catalogue import

Hi Priya, handing over the Lornbeck Library import job for review. The parser now normalizes MARC-ish records before dedup, and I added a quarantine queue for records missing call numbers rather than dropping them silently. Watch the merge logic in `reconcile.py` — it assumes publisher names are already trimmed. The nightly run finished clean twice. The importer currently runs with the following configuration values.

settings of bawif-fawif:
ralix:
  log_level: warn
  metrics_host: metrics.ralix.tolvaqsys.internal
  pool_size: 32

The TilePorter prefetcher for Cartwheel Maps reads its configuration entirely from environment variables at startup. Release builds need the upstream tile endpoint, the cache size limit, and the fetch concurrency set before packaging. Most values ship with sane defaults. The only entry that must be supplied manually per release is the following line:

env line for yageg-kahip: COURIER_KEY20=bd8cf971b90c4183e503

Subject: Visitor handling this week

Hi all,

Quick reminder from the front desk: every visitor needs to sign the tablet AND get a lanyard before going past the gate — no exceptions, even for the Brockfield contractors. Walk them to the lift if they look lost. If the tablet freezes, use the paper log in the drawer. The escort door uses the code below.

staff pass of yageg-fafog = bdg-A-76